James Lynn Strait was an American lead vocalist and songwriter, famously known for his contributions to the California punk rock band, Snot. His major work was showcased in their debut album, Get Some, which was released in 1997. James Lynn Strait was born on August 7, 1968 in New York, United States. James Lynn Strait Biography and Facts
- Who is James Lynn Strait?: James Lynn Strait was an American musician, primarily recognized for his work with the California punk rock band, Snot. He was best known for his vocal and songwriting skills in the band.
- Early Life: Strait was born and raised in Manhasset, New York. However, he moved to southern California during his high school years.
- Musical Career: Before joining Snot, Strait played bass for a heavy metal band called Lethal Dose.
- Snot’s Debut Album: Strait’s prominent work was his contribution to Snot’s first album, Get Some. The album was released in 1997.
- Legacy: Strait was the subject of “Angel’s Son,” a song performed by Morgan Rose’s band, Sevendust.
- Tragic End: At the age of thirty, Strait was killed in an automobile accident that occurred on his way from Santa Barbara to Los Angeles, California.
